I am around long enough to remember when courthouses were the responsibility of local authorities, which did not really want them. Courthouses were run down because of the lack of finance and resources going into them. There are many things we could vote against or criticise but this is constructive and positive. It is important to separate out family courts. This is a very good start. We have been waiting far too long. We know the background to the proposed building on Hammond Lane. This is most certainly a start. We need to see it expanded to other areas. Even if only interim arrangements are made in other areas, it is important to have that separation because it is daunting for anyone to have to go into a courthouse. When family court issues are separated out, it is a far better experience for people who are going to find the experience difficult anyway. We will be supporting this legislation.
